#root,.App,html{height:100%}:root,:root.light{--background-color:#fff;--color:#212529;--hr-color:rgba(0,0,0,0.10196078431372549);--text-muted-color:#6c757d;--margin-color:#ccc;--card-background:#fff;--modal-background:#fff;--header-background:#f8f9fa;--nav-brand-color:rgba(0,0,0,0.9019607843137255);--nav-link-color:rgba(0,0,0,0.5019607843137255);--nav-link-active-color:rgba(0,0,0,0.9019607843137255);--recent-posts-time-color:#666;--highlighted-projects-card-color:#f9f9f9}@media (prefers-color-scheme:dark){:root{--background-color:#1f1f1f;--color:#fff;--hr-color:#fff;--text-muted-color:#a8adb2;--margin-color:#494949;--card-background:#3c3c3c;--modal-background:#212529;--header-background:#343a40;--nav-brand-color:#fff;--nav-link-color:hsla(0,0%,100%,0.5019607843137255);--nav-link-active-color:#fff;--recent-posts-time-color:#5eddac;--highlighted-projects-card-color:#2c2c2c}}:root.dark{--background-color:#1f1f1f;--color:#fff;--hr-color:#fff;--text-muted-color:#a8adb2!important;--margin-color:#494949;--card-background:#3c3c3c;--modal-background:#212529;--header-background:#343a40!important;--nav-brand-color:#fff!important;--nav-link-color:hsla(0,0%,100%,0.5019607843137255)!important;--nav-link-active-color:#fff!important;--recent-posts-time-color:#5eddac;--highlighted-projects-card-color:#2c2c2c}body{margin:0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;height:100%;font-size:1.3rem;background-color:var(--background-color);color:var(--color)}div.app-container{margin-bottom:4rem}hr{border-top-color:var(--hr-color)}.table{color:var(--color)}.text-muted{color:var(--text-muted-color)!important}div.container{margin-top:5%;margin-bottom:5%;margin-left:auto}@media (min-width:768px){div.container{width:50%}}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ace;color:#f8f8f2;max-width:90%;display:block}code.inline{color:#e83e8c;display:inline}.code-block{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ace!important;color:#f8f8f2!important;margin-bottom:15px}@media (min-width:768px){.code-block{position:relative;left:-10%;width:120%}}div.code-block button{border-width:0}div.left-margin,div.right-margin{background-color:var(--margin-color);z-index:-1}div.full-height{height:100%}div.col{padding:0}div.container-headshot{padding-left:5%;padding-right:5%;padding-top:5%;margin-bottom:20px}img.headshot{width:40%;min-width:200px}div.bio{max-width:1000px}div.bio-col{padding-left:10%;padding-right:10%}h1.name-title{margin-top:30px}div.blog-card{margin:30px 15px;padding:30px;align-items:center}img.github-intext{height:20px;width:20px}blockquote.blockquote{border-left:10px solid #ccc;padding-left:20px;padding-top:15px;padding-bottom:15px;margin-top:10px;margin-bottom:10px;font-style:italic}pre{background-color:#212529;padding:.5rem;border-radius:.5rem;color:#38fe27}img.card-img-top{max-width:20rem}.card{background-color:var(--card-background)}.card-columns{column-count:1}@media (min-width:1200px){.card-columns{column-count:2;padding-right:15px}}div.form-card{margin:auto}input.crypto-calc-input{width:75%!important}div.crypto-calc-row{padding-bottom:25px}div.tennis-form-container{font-size:14px;padding-left:0;padding-right:0}@media (min-width:1200px){div.tennis-form-container{max-width:75%;font-size:18px}}div.modal{padding-right:15px!important}.modal-open{overflow:auto}div.modal-content{background-color:var(--modal-background)}.App{text-align:left;font-size:1.1rem}img.navbar-icon{margin-right:10px}a.nav-link{font-size:20px}button.subscribe-modal-btn{color:#000;text-decoration:none;font-size:20px;padding-left:0}button.subscribe-modal-btn:hover{color:var(--nav-brand-color);text-decoration:none}nav.navbar{background-color:var(--header-background)}a.navbar-brand,button.subscribe-modal-btn{color:var(--nav-brand-color)}a.nav-link.active{color:var(--nav-link-active-color)}.navbar-toggler-icon,a.nav-link{color:var(--nav-link-color)}.darkModeToggle{margin-top:auto}.switch{font-size:17px;position:relative;display:inline-block;width:64px;height:34px}.switch input{opacity:0;width:0;height:0}.slider{cursor:pointer;top:0;left:0;right:0;bottom:0;background-color:#73c0fc;border-radius:30px}.slider,.slider:before{position:absolute;transition:.4s}.slider:before{content:"";height:30px;width:30px;border-radius:20px;left:2px;bottom:2px;z-index:2;background-color:#e8e8e8}.sun svg{top:6px;left:36px}.moon svg,.sun svg{position:absolute;z-index:1;width:24px;height:24px}.moon svg{fill:#73c0fc;top:5px;left:5px}.sun svg{animation:rotate 15s linear infinite}@keyframes rotate{0%{transform:rotate(0)}to{transform:rotate(1turn)}}.moon svg{animation:tilt 5s linear infinite}@keyframes tilt{0%{transform:rotate(0deg)}25%{transform:rotate(-10deg)}75%{transform:rotate(10deg)}to{transform:rotate(0deg)}}.input:checked+.slider{background-color:#183153}.input:focus+.slider{box-shadow:0 0 1px #183153}.input:checked+.slider:before{transform:translateX(30px)}p.tagline{font-size:1.7rem}img.img-profile{width:100%}@media (max-width:1200px){img.img-profile{max-width:165px}}time.recent-posts-time{color:var(--recent-posts-time-color);font-family:monospace}a.recent-posts-link{color:unset}div.home-intro{margin-bottom:40px}div.highlighted-projects-card{background-color:var(--highlighted-projects-card-color)}p.highlighted-projects-card-text{font-size:.9rem}.highlighted-project-button{padding:.5rem .6rem}div.highlighted-projects-buttons{display:flex;flex-wrap:wrap;grid-gap:.5rem;gap:.5rem}div.favorite-links-container{padding-top:15px}ul.favorite-links-ul{padding-inline-start:15px}div.post-header-img{min-width:30%;float:left;padding-right:30px}div.post-img-right{min-width:30vh;float:right;padding-left:30px}div.post-img-left{min-width:30vh;float:left;margin-right:30px}img.post-img{margin-bottom:1rem}img.post-img-bordered{border:2px;border-style:solid}.figure{display:table;width:-moz-fit-content;width:fit-content}figcaption.figure-caption{display:table-caption;caption-side:bottom;padding-top:15px}p.post-body{justify-content:left}.monty-hall-button-text{font-size:30px}.monty-hall-button-col{padding-top:15px}.monty-hall-play-again{padding-left:15px}div.footer-container{padding-top:170px}@media (min-width:992px){div.footer-container{padding-top:110px}}@media (min-width:1200px){div.footer-container{padding-top:95px}}footer.footer{position:absolute;bottom:0;padding:20px;width:100%;background-color:#f5f5f5;text-align:center}div.footer-col{display:inline-block;text-align:left}img.footer-icon{margin-right:10px;margin-bottom:5px}h3.footer-brand{display:inline-block;max-width:80%}footer.footer{background-color:var(--header-background);color:var(--color)}.minecraft-guide-container{text-align:left}.minecraft-inline{height:35px;width:35px}.minecraft-yield{height:40px;width:40px;margin-top:2px;margin-left:2px}.crafting-table-container{text-align:left;background-color:#c6c6c6;height:150px;width:300px;margin-top:15px;margin-bottom:15px;border-color:#dbdbdb #5b5b5b #5b5b5b #dbdbdb;border-style:solid;border-width:2px;border-image-source:none;border-image-slice:100%;border-image-width:1;border-image-outset:0;border-image-repeat:initial}.crafting-table-grid{padding-top:15px;padding-left:15px}.crafting-table-row{margin-left:15px;margin-right:15px}.crafting-table-col{height:40px;width:40px}.crafting-table-col,.crafting-table-yield{background-color:#8b8b8b;border-color:#373737 #fff #fff #373737;border-style:solid;border-width:2px;border-image-source:none;border-image-slice:100%;border-image-width:1;border-image-outset:0;border-image-repeat:initial}.crafting-table-yield{margin-top:auto;margin-bottom:auto;margin-left:30px;height:50px;width:50px}.crafting-table-yield-size{position:relative;right:-32px;bottom:17px;font-weight:400!important;color:#fff!important;text-shadow:2px 2px 0 #3f3f3f;filter:dropshadow(color=#3F3F3F,offx=2,offy=2);z-index:2}.crafting-table-arrow{margin-top:auto;margin-bottom:auto;width:45px;height:30px}.furnace-container{text-align:left;background-color:#c6c6c6;height:150px;width:215px;margin-top:15px;margin-bottom:15px;border-color:#dbdbdb #5b5b5b #5b5b5b #dbdbdb;border-style:solid;border-width:2px;border-image-source:none;border-image-slice:100%;border-image-width:1;border-image-outset:0;border-image-repeat:initial}.smelting-fire{margin-left:auto}
/*# sourceMappingURL=main.45464b7c.chunk.css.map */